How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Minnetonka?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Minnetonka Studio Apartments | $1,545 | $1,031 | $2,558 |
| Minnetonka 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,810 | $999 | $10,000+ |
| Minnetonka 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,564 | $1,231 | $10,000+ |
Minnetonka 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,614 | $1,700 | $10,000+ |

Cheapest Available Minnetonka 3 Bedroom Apartments
As of July 09, 2026 the lowest priced 3 Bedroom apartment unit in Minnetonka, MN is the Three Bedroom B Model starting from $1,829 at Bren Road Station 55+ Apartments in the Glen Lake neighborhood. The second most affordable Minnetonka 3 Bedroom is the 3BR/1.0BA Model at Wayzata Lake Apartments starting at $1,855 in the Groveland neighborhood. The average price for all 3 Bedroom apartments in Minnetonka is currently $3,614.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 3 Bedroom options in Minnetonka: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
|---|---|---|
| Bren Road Station 55+ Apartments | Three Bedroom B | $1,829 |
| Wayzata Lake Apartments | 3BR/1.0BA | $1,855 |
| Shadow Green Apartments | Elm | $1,871 |
| Crown Ridge Apartments | Kennedy | $1,978 |
| Stratford Wood | Stratford | $2,009 |
| The Ensley | Harrington - D1-A - 60% | $2,065 |
| Shelard Village Apartments | The Robin | $2,095 |
| Gleason Lake | Aster | $2,265 |
| The Ridge Apartments | Three Bedroom | $2,300 |
| Minnetonka Hills Apartments | 3 Bedroom | $2,359 |
